The role

CBCity have an exciting new opportunity to join our Planning Department as a Building Compliance Officer. Reporting directly to the Team Leader Building Compliance, you will respond to complaints relating to unauthorised building work, non-compliant building work and dilapidated buildings work by completing investigations and undertaking enforcement actions as an investigations officer as defined under the Environmental Planning and Assessment (EP&A) Act 1979 in relation to Council's role. 

You will educate and direct the community regarding applicable planning and building controls including but not limited to; Environmental Planning and Assessment Act 1979 and associated regulations, Canterbury Bankstown Local Environmental Plan 2023, Canterbury Bankstown Development Control Plan 2023, relevant State Environmental Planning Policies and the National Construction Code.

Duties will include but not be limited to:

  • Undertake site inspections, gather evidence and undertake interviews with relevant persons to investigate breaches to the Environmental Planning and Assessment (EP&A) Act 1979 in a timely, professional and well-documented manner.
  • Investigate reported non-compliance with development consents and undertake appropriate enforcement action in a timely manner including liaison and coordination with appointed Principal Certifiers where applicable.
  • Undertake timely investigations of dilapidated structures or buildings to evaluate risks to public safety and undertake appropriate enforcement action as required.
  • Review available enforcement actions such as issuance of penalty notices, issuance of development control orders, issuance of cautions or other regulatory controls prescribed by the EP&A Act.
  • Prepare statement of evidence in relation to building compliance matters and attend the Land and Environment Court as an expert witness as required.
  • Assist Certifiers and Principal Certifiers (PCs) with enforcement action as required to address non-compliant developments and handle complaints against PCs including making reports to Fair Trading regarding PC misconduct as required.
